50. Blue Ribbon BBQ
Lala I./YelpLocation: Arlington, Massachusetts
Foursquare rating: 9.23
Inspired by roadside barbecue joints down South, Blue Ribbon BBQ opened its doors over 20 years ago to bring those same flavors to another part of the country. Today, the spot still serves a host of authentic Southern dishes, including North Carolina pulled pork, Kansas City burnt ends, St. Louis cut ribs, and Texas sliced beef brisket.
49. Hutchins BBQ & Grill
Lucy Z/YelpLocation: McKinney, Texas
Foursquare rating: 9.24
It's all-you-can-eat at Huchins BBQ & Grill, so pile it on and dig into melt-in-your-mouth brisket, jalapeño sausage, smoked chicken, and more. Foursquare users cheer the fried okra as well. The place gets crowded, so come prepared to fight for a table.
48. Phil's BBQ
Phil's BBQ/FacebookLocation: San Diego, California
Foursquare rating: 9.24
Even in Southern California, it's possible to find outstanding barbecue if you know where to look. Phil's BBQ always draws a line out the door.
"I grew up in the South and had all kinds of barbecue. I did not think you could have such flavorful beef ribs in San Diego," Foursquare user Timothy Mabrey said. "Service is fast, but go during off hours to avoid waiting in a long line."
